miriam gideon – sonnet xxxiii lyrics
Loading...
full many a glorious morning have i seen
flatter the mountain-tops with sovereign eye
kissing with golden face the meadows green
gilding pale streams with heavenly alchemy;
anon permit the basest clouds to ride
with ugly rack on his celestial face
and from the forlorn world his visage hide
stealing unseen to west with this disgrace:
even so my sun one early morn did shine
with all triumphant splendor on my brow;
but out, alack! he was but one hour mine;
the region cloud hath mask’d him from me now
yet him for this my love no whit disdaineth;
suns of the world may stain when heaven’s sun staineth
